Patterson to coach and play at Manurewa AFC

New Zealand international striker Monty Patterson is confirmed to coach and at the same time play at the newly-promoted Northern League club Manurewa AFC this season.

The former All White will play in the Northern League but has been named as head coach for the club’s U-23 side, Rewa’s U-17 and U-19 teams for their national tournaments in late 2023.

The 26-year-old returns for a second season with Manurewa AFC after joining the club from Auckland United.

His move into coaching adds to the strengthening of Rewa’s coaching staff also with the arrival of veteran coach Paul Marshall who will help head coach Rhys Ruka.

Marshall left his role as Director of Football at Onehunga Mangere United at the end of last season.

Meanwhile, Manurewa AFC features players from Fiji such as Ishtiyaq Shah and Mohammed Muzakkir Nabeel and Argentinian Nicolas Bobadilla who helped Ba win the recent Pacific Cup in Nadi.
